
NVIDIA's RTX 50-series 'Blackwell' laptop GPUs are driving a new wave of high-performance gaming laptops for 2025, as exemplified by premium models from key manufacturers like Alienware, Asus, and MSI. These devices, featuring advanced processors and graphics, target the high-end market segment, offering desktop-replacement capabilities for demanding gamers and content creators, underscoring ongoing innovation and competitive dynamics in the specialized PC hardware sector.
The article highlights the impending launch of NVIDIA's RTX 50-series "Blackwell" laptop GPUs in 2025, signaling a significant technological advancement for the high-performance gaming and content creation market. These new GPUs, integrated into premium laptops from manufacturers like Alienware (Dell), Asus, and MSI, promise desktop-replacement capabilities with features such as ray-traced graphics and AI acceleration, targeting a demanding user base. This development underscores a continued innovation cycle in specialized PC hardware. Key system builders are pairing these NVIDIA GPUs with Intel's latest processors, including the Core Ultra 9 275HX and i7-14650HX, to deliver uncompromised performance. Specific models like the Alienware 18 Area-51 and Asus ROG Strix SCAR 16, featuring the RTX 5090, are positioned to cater to the top-tier segment, emphasizing high frame rates and immersive experiences for AAA gaming and professional applications. This strategic focus on high-end specifications suggests a pursuit of higher-margin opportunities within the PC market.
